A Kildare man charged with murder has appeared in court again.
Padraig Delaney, 43, whose address was given as 6 The Lane, Eustace Demesne, Naas, faces an allegation of the murder of 37 year old Shane Knott between April 3-14, at that address.
He appeared via video link at Naas District court today.
Solicitor Tim Kennelly told the court that he has secured the services of a pathologist, Professor Jack Crane, to review images from the post mortem examination of the deceased and prepare “an independent report.”
Mr Kennelly said today it’s likely it won’t be not be necessary to have an “in person examination” of the deceased.
Mr Kennelly also said a forensics expert arrived from the UK last night and will examine the crime scene.
He also said that a bail application will be made in the High Court next week
Judge Desmond Zaidan remanded the defendant in custody to appear again by video link May 2 . He said if the defendant secures bail in the meantime he must appear in court on that date.
